It is an automatic. I did not keep track of the mileage before the overhaul, but afterwards it has ranged from 26-28. This is mostly on my work commute, which is freeway speed (I try to keep it under 70). During the break-in period I was careful to not do any sustained freeway speeds.
As for the head gasket, it is supposed to be the right one. In any case, the hoels lined up exactly. I made sure to check that.
Also, oil consumption is much less, less than 0.5 qt. in 2500 mi.
